The costs and benefits of a vaccination programme for Haemophilus influenzae type B disease

Insights

Implementing Haemophilus influenzae type b (Hib) vaccination in South Africa offers significant economic advantages. A hypothetical vaccination program for the 1992 birth cohort demonstrated net benefits ranging from R2.4 to R3.5 million.

Background:

  • Haemophilus influenzae type b (Hib) causes severe bacterial infections in young children globally, particularly in South Africa.
  • Hib infections are preventable through conjugate Hib vaccines, yet these are not routinely administered in South Africa.
  • This study evaluates the economic impact of a hypothetical Hib vaccination program in South Africa.

Purpose of the Study:

  • To measure the expected net economic benefits of a Haemophilus influenzae type b (Hib) vaccination program.
  • To assess the cost-effectiveness of introducing Hib vaccines into the routine immunization schedule for the 1992 Cape Town birth cohort.

Main Methods:

  • Calculated direct medical care costs and indirect costs (human capital, willingness-to-pay) associated with Hib disease.
  • Determined the costs of a hypothetical Hib vaccination program (HibTITER, Praxis Biologicals).
  • Calculated net benefits by subtracting vaccination program costs from estimated Hib disease costs.

Main Results:

  • Estimated economic costs of Hib disease for the 1992 Cape Town cohort ranged from R10.7 to R11.8 million without a vaccination program.
  • The cost of introducing the hypothetical Hib vaccination program was R8.3 million.
  • Net benefits from vaccinating the 1992 birth cohort were estimated between R2.4 million and R3.5 million.

Conclusions:

  • A hypothetical Haemophilus influenzae type b (Hib) vaccination program for the 1992 Cape Town birth cohort would yield substantial net economic benefits.
  • Vaccination is a cost-effective strategy for reducing the burden of Hib disease in South Africa.
  • The findings support the integration of conjugate Hib vaccines into routine immunization schedules.
